I want to heartily recommend the book, Gentle and Lowly: The Heart of Christ for Sinners and Sufferers, by Dane Ortlund. Our men’s Tuesday night study just finished discussing the book last month. Here are a few reviews from some of our men.
“The study gave a new perspective on the vastness of Christ’s love for us and a needed reminder of his passion to forgive and comfort his children, along with his deep desire for us to turn to him, especially when we feel we are at our lowest spiritually. The author was especially gifted in showing the immeasurable gentleness, humbleness and accessibility of our Lord Jesus,” Don Depoorter.
“My take home is that we really don’t appreciate and or focus on just how much the Lord truly loves us. It’s all in God’s Word, do we see it? Do we actually embrace it?” Paul Recher.
“Gentle and Lowly takes the child of God, personally, deep into the heart of God, Jesus, and the Holy Spirit; and assures us of the incredible, unlimited, unearned love that awaits us there,” Nic Martin.
“A book that will move the young Christian struggling with assurance, and a reminder to older Christians going through dark times of doubt, that God is still there waiting to help them,” Bill Gilliam.
